Buckeye Partners is currently seeking a Specialist, M&QC I with 5+ years' pipeline/terminal experience with quality and measurement exposure preferred in the Oil & Gas Industry to join our team!



Role Summary:

Responsible for implementing measurement and quality control policies, training, and supporting asset teams within the assigned district.



Responsibilities & Essential Functions include:Review meter factor exceptions monthly and recognize changes/issues (Meter Factor Regression Tool, Terminal Meter Factor Tool, etc.).
Monitor pipeline and terminal over/short monthly and terminal folio comments and recognize changes/issues.
Train field personnel on:
Product sampling, testing, cut procedures, product specifications, regulatory requirements, and response to quality problems.
Measurement procedures, tolerances, and response to measurement problems.
Assist in the resolution of measurement and quality problems. Obtain assistance where necessary when troubleshooting or investigating problems.
Participate in investigation of Operational Incidents. Document details and findings in an online incident reporting tool. Prepare Investigation Reports when required.
Assist and advise shippers, as needed, to maintain conformance with Buckeye measurement and quality control policies.
Audit terminals under the Buckeye Terminal Measurement Audit program. Identify Action Items, responsible parties, and completion dates and follow-up to ensure action items are completed.
Maintain updated meter and prover information in centralized database (BLIS).
Assist in the installation, setup, calibration, and monitoring of new measurement or quality monitoring equipment. Update measurement and lab equipment databases.
Lead prover setup, waterdraw and return to service, and coordinate waterdraws with Field Operations, Scheduling, and waterdraw contractor. Witness Buckeye and connecting facility waterdraws.
Present Operational Excellence periodic updates to field locations.
Support Terminal Operations in various aspects of blending (busted blend remediation, ethanol/biodiesel content, midgrades) and additive injection (lubricity HFRR tracking, red dye content, cold flow, conductivity, gasoline VARs, etc).
Become proficient using Measurement Performance Indicators using M&QC SharePoint site.
Maintain proficiency in DNA@Web (CC SCADA software) for quality and measurement investigations
And other duties as assigned.

In addition to owning and operating a global network of integrated assets providing liquid petroleum product logistical solutions, We are one of the largest independent liquid petroleum product pipeline operators in the United States with approximately 6,000 miles of pipeline. Our global terminal network comprises more than 115 terminals located across the many regions of the United States and the Caribbean. Our flagship marine terminal in The Bahamas is one of the largest marine crude oil and refined petroleum product storage facilities in the world. Through Swift Current, we have commercialized approximately 10 gigawatts of clean energy projects across North America.
